Just check that the two transverse seals across the roof that join the flat bit to the front cab and rear top mouldings are not lifting. This can happen at around ten years and if so, they have to be replaced / resealed. I believe Jock had it done by Mark of CLS if I recall correctly. Also can be fixed by Peter Hambilton. Not a particularly cheap job to do properly I understand.
